Subjectbt878 channel changing problems
(Linux lithium 2.2.0-pre7-ac4 #68 Fri Jan 15 14:06:47 EST 1999 i586 unknown)


output from modprobe tuner:
i2c: initialized

output from modprobe bttv:
Linux video capture interface: v1.00
bttv0: Brooktree Bt878 (rev 2) bus: 0, devfn: 64, irq: 9, memory: 0xe8001000.
PCI: Enabling bus mastering for device 00:40
bttv: 1 Bt8xx card(s) found.
bttv0: Hauppauge eeprom: tuner=Philips FM1236 (2)
bttv0: audio chip: TDA9850
bttv0: model: BT878(Hauppauge new)

Yet, I cannot change the channel in xawtv when I've attached coaxial from my antenna
to the bt878's tuner. Does using the v4l driver as a module or compiled in to the
kernel make a difference?
